A typical day
I love to stimulate your fur baby physically and mentally by playing ball, go find it , find the treat, and various games to bond at first is a must. Time for a walk to discover new smells and surroundings in the beautiful local parks is a must. A treat here and there is with some fresh cold water to rehydrate. Then it’s back home to relax and have a nap, listening to calming dog music to help your fur baby sleep. After a good nap it’s time to go outside for a toilet break and then it’s playtime with catching bubbles with my dog friendly bacon flavoured bubbles and including one of my favourite toys (Tug rope) to play a bit of tug of war. Learning toy names and new commands.

Pet care experience
Hello, Pet Parents! I am a lifelong animal lover with experience caring for dogs, cats, rabbits, birds, and even fish. Growing up surrounded by animals, I naturally became the trusted pet sitter for family and friends whenever they were away. Originally from South Africa, I moved to the UK three years ago and turned my passion for animals into a full-time role. I now live in Bordon, Hampshire, where I provide a safe, loving, and comfortable home-from-home experience for your pets. I understand that every dog is unique and deserves individual attention. That’s why I only care for one dog at a time, ensuring they receive plenty of love, companionship, and personalised care. The only exception is for dogs from the same family, and I am happy to welcome siblings together so they can stay with a familiar companion. I am patient, trustworthy, energetic, and genuinely passionate about animal welfare. As I am home throughout the week, your dog will never be left feeling lonely and will enjoy lots of attention, cuddles, playtime, and companionship throughout the day. Although I don’t have a garden, I am fortunate to be surrounded by beautiful parks, woodland walks, and dog-friendly outdoor spaces in and around Bordon. This means your dog will enjoy plenty of exercise, mental stimulation, and fresh air, with walks tailored to their age, energy level, and needs. Your pet’s safety and wellbeing are always my highest priority. I can’t wait to meet your best friend!

We are indebted to Mandi for caring for Archie for a week whilst we were skiing over Christmas. He had stayed with her before for two trial nights, and clearly loved all his stays as he races inside to see Mandi when we arrive, and he is very happy to see us, but in no rush to depart when we collect him. During his stay, as the only guest, he had lots and lots of attention from Mandi and her husband as they took him out on lots of walking adventures and also gave him lots of mental stimulus with toys, garden games, training, lick matts, new foods to try etc. Mandi also gave us lots of valuable feedback and ideas for our life at home, and his future stays with her (Archie is a rescue that we have had for just 2 1/2 months, so we are still in-training and learning with him). Mandi's kindness was truly exceptional in every respect, especially as Archie has some quirks and is quite an active dog, and Christmas is a busy time for everyone (plus a very sad event made it harder), yet we still received lots of amazing videos and photos each day, a detailed daily diary update, and even poems celebrating the joys of his stay :-). When we collected him he had been bathed, blow-dried and brushed and all his towels and raincoats etc washed too - quite a challenge with his spaniel affinity for mud. He also had a new toy, his Father Christmas - a charming and thoughtful gift from Mandi and her husband. We cannot thank them enough: the peace-of-mind of knowing Archie was happy and cared for so well made our trip perfect, and we would not hesitate to recommend Mandi to anyone else using Rover.
